Can't create Geography address, country/region field is empty

Hi,

 

I'm using Fortigate-30E running FortiOS v6.2.16 build1392 (GA).

 

Not sure when it happened, but I can't create geography address anymore. It worked in the past.

As can be seen in the picture, the country/region field is empty with no entries.

Hi,

After I've opened a ticket, I received from Fortinet a custom build (FGT_30E-v6-build5262-FORTINET.out) which solved the problem after upgrading.

I mean that following: https://docs.fortinet.com/document/fortigate/6.2.16/fortios-release-notes/413989

 

Step 1: Since the initial state of the /data partition on the flash card is close to 100%, manually delete the GEOIP Database to avoid upgrade failure or loss of configuration files when upgrading the firmware:

 

Output:

FortiGate-30E # diagnose geoip delete-geoip-db
This operation will delete the Geoip Database and reboot the system!
Only super admin has the permission with the command.
Do you want to continue? (y/n)y

Admin:admin
Password: *********
Error: unable to delete the /etc/geoip_db.gz file. No such file or directory

 

 

Step 2: Upgrade the FortiGate to the new firmware. Once completed, the GEOIP V2 Database is installed. Verify the installation:

Since my machine is already with the most recent firmware, what can I do here?
